The BlackBoard

A rabbi who was walking through a small town saw a
blackboard outside the side door of a school. It had just been
washed and put out to dry in the open air. There was a piece
of chalk in the tray of the blackboard, so the rabbi took it and
wrote in large letters, "I'm a rabbi and I pray for you all."
Now a lawyer happened to pass soon, and when he saw the rabbi's
note, he added under it, "I'm a lawyer and I defend you all."
Then a doctor came by, took the piece of chalk and wrote on
the blackboard, "I'm a doctor and I cure you all."
Finally an ordinary citizen stopped to read the growing list,
thought for a few seconds and then added, "I'm just your average guy,
and I pay for you all."
